Why is it so hard to quit social media?

There are a few reasons why it can be hard to quit social media. For one, social media is addictive. It’s designed to keep you hooked, so it’s no wonder it’s hard to break free. Additionally, many of us rely on social media for work or networking purposes, so we feel like we need to stay connected. Finally, we can feel like we’re missing out if we’re not constantly updated on what’s happening online.

How do you take a break off social media?

There are a few ways to take a break from social media. One way is to delete the apps from your phone. Another way is to disable notifications. You can also set a time limit for how long you’re going to be on social media each day.
